WebThe Lap steel guitar is not tuned in standard guitar tuning (E-A-D-G-B-E, low to high). Rather, it is usually tuned to an open chord, often an extended chord like a 6th, 7th, or 9th. All … WebMay 13, 2010 · Always start with the string below your target pitch and slowly raise the string up to your desired pitch. If you start with the string higher than your target pitch and then tune down to your note, you're going to have problems. Because of the metal-on-metal construction of tuning gears there is inherent "slack" in the system. chinchilla playing https://doddnation.com

WebApr 24, 2024 · We carry string sets designed for 6 string A6th, C6th, E13th, and E7th tunings as well as 8 string A6th, C6th, E13th, and E7th tunings. These sets will work on non pedal lap steels, some table steels and some pedal steel guitars. Lap steel guitar strings are designed to be used only on steel guitars. Tuning for steel guitar in C6 is one of the most often used tunings, and can be found on instruments with single or double necks. A twin-neck guitar is most commonly set up with C6 tuning on the near neck and E9 tuning on the far neck. This is the most frequent configuration.

WebBlues and Rock players tend to favor one of two tuning families: open G/open A, or open D/open E. Open A raises each of those notes a whole-step (2 frets) to E-A-E-A-C#-E. During the 1920s and 1930s, much of the sheet music written for lap steel utilized open A tuning as the de facto standard tuning for the instrument. C6th tuning is also common.

Beat 1 illustrates a pull-off on the 3rd string. Simply place the bar over the 1st fret marker, pluck A, and lift the bar off the string. If you raise the bar cleanly, the open 3rd string will ring out nice and loud.
